I saw someone raise this point on Reddit too and it made me curious. Do you mean that from like a realistic perspective, or that you just prefer easily identifiable buildings in Lego? Because where I'm from the buildings are old and rebuilt or repurposed multiple times. The only way to identify the type of shop is by signs or window displays and on top it's apartments or office space, usually pretty anonymous. I think that might actually be part of why I like this, hotels and museums are easy identifiable but the rest of city centres usually aren't. -
